  • Concordia Handbell Invitational 2023

    March 18, 2023 @ 12:00 pm - 5:30 pm
    1530 Concordia, Irvine CA 92612

    During this ½ day event, you will hone and refresh yourringing skills by learning a piece of music under the tutelage of Concordia'sHandbell Faculty and members of Concordia's top ensemble. If your full ensemblecomes, you will have a piece of music ready to perform with only 1 or 2 morerehearsals. The format for the workshop is a typical rehearsal of a pieceinterspersed with technique workshops.  We will review proper technique aswell as proper execution of articulations, all the while having fun doing whatwe love. All Church, Community, and high school ensembles or individual ringersare welcome!

    The afternoon will culminate in a concert featuring each participating ensembleand the Concordia University Handbell ensembles. The intention of this event isto learn, experience the greater handbell community, and perform for anaudience of handbell fans in our beautiful concert hall. Full ensembles,partial ensembles, and individual ringers are all welcome. 

    Ensembles will need to bring their own handbells, pads, cloths, etc. We willprovide tables. We may be able to provide substitute ringers if you have gapsin your ensemble. Ensembles are invited toperform 1 or 2 pieces during the afternoon concert. Thiswill be a fantastic performance opportunity!
